Bank of America (NYSE:BAC) Earns Sell Rating from Cfra

Bank of America (NYSE:BAC)‘s stock had its “sell” rating reiterated by equities research analysts at Cfra in a research note issued to investors on Tuesday, Benzinga reports. They currently have a $39.00 target price on the financial services provider’s stock. Cfra’s price target points to a potential downside of 11.94% from the company’s previous close.

Bank of America (NYSE:BACG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Tuesday, July 16th. The financial services provider reported $0.83 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.81 by $0.02. Bank of America had a return on equity of 10.88% and a net margin of 13.94%. The business had revenue of $25.38 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$25.22 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$0.88 EPS. Bank of America’s revenue for the quarter was up .7%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, equities analysts forecast that Bank of America will post 3.22 earnings per share for the current year.

Bank of America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Bank of America Corporation, through its subsidiaries, provides banking and financial products and services for individual consumers, small and middle-market businesses, institutional investors, large corporations, and governments worldwide. It operates in four segments: Consumer Banking, Global Wealth & Investment Management (GWIM), Global Banking, and Global Markets.
